Abstract

The utility model discloses a novel air valve of a storage bag. The novel air valve of the storage bag comprises an air valve bottom and an air valve bonnet, and is characterized by further comprising a washer which is mounted in the air valve bottom, the air valve bonnet is mounted on the air valve bottom in a threaded manner, a conical surface is arranged at the rear end of the air valve bottom, a plurality of protruding bevel edges are uniformly arranged on the conical surface of the air valve bottom, an airway opening is arranged at the center of the conical surface and communicated with an airway inside the air valve, a cylindrical structure is arranged at the rear end of the air valve bottom, an outer thread is arranged on the cylindrical structure, the washer is provided with an internal cylindrical structure and mounted on a transitional portion between a narrower section and a wider section of the airway, a thread matched with the outer thread of the cylindrical structure of the air valve bottom is arranged inside the air valve bonnet, and a through cavity communicated with the airway of the air valve bottom is arranged at the center inside the air valve bonnet.

Background technology
Known collecting bag is mainly used to take in can compressed soft article, and such as clothing, cotton-wadded quilt etc. dwindled the volume of these article whereby, and minimizing contacts with air, so are conducive to carry or collection for a long time.Known collecting bag is in order to discharge unnecessary air in bag after taking in article, can be provided with blow off valve at chosen place, the aspirate tube that utilizes blow off valve to offer dust collecting fan or other air extractor connects, an air in quick whereby extraction bag also can allow the user adopt the mode of extruding collecting bag to extrude a bag interior air.Known blow off valve, its internal implementation have comparatively complicated structure and many spare parts, therefore cause manufacturing cost to increase.

Air valve is mounted in the air door on collecting bag, after it is used air extracting pump or dust collecting fan the air in bag is extracted out, makes the volume of storage of objects in bag greatly reduce namely to reduce to account for capacity, thereby improves the space of life.It is to use air extracting pump, relies on the rotation of air valve cap to come compress gasket completely cut off the inside and outside airiness of bag, otherwise the air valve cap counter-rotating guarantees that the air inside and outside bag is unblocked at the bottom of making pad break away from air valve.
